Nellie G. Weakley, 92, of Dyersburg, died Sunday, January 1, 2012 at Dyersburg Regional Medical Center.

She was a homemaker, member of First United Methodist Church, where she attended Community Bible Study and a member of Potts Price Sunday School Class and a member of Tuesday Bridge Club.

Services will be at 3 p.m. Tuesday in the chapel of Dyersburg Funeral Home with Dr. David Russell officiating. Burial will be in Fairview Cemetery.

The family will receive visitors from 1:30-3 p.m. Tuesday at the funeral home.

Survivors include her son, Tommy Weakley and wife, Susanne, of Dyersburg; two grandchildren, Tommie Sue Roach and husband Taylor and Christopher Weakley and wife Robyn, all of Nashville; and one great-grandson, Clayton Roach of Nashville.

She was preceded in death by her husband, Melvin T. "Toppy" Weakley; a daughter, Marilyn Merritt; and her parents, Harry and Maggie Woods George.

Pallbearers will be Tracy Latham, Billy Ozment, Jerry Mac Roberson, Ralph Richardson, Chip Finley, Christopher Weakley and Taylor Roach.
